Bug 1242076

Summary: Switch python3-gobject requirement to python3-gobject-base
Product: [Fedora] Fedora Reporter: Stephen Gallagher <sgallagh>
Component: firewalldAssignee: Thomas Woerner <twoerner>
Status: CLOSED NEXTRELEASE Q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: medium Docs Contact:
Priority: medium    
Version: 23CC: jpopelka, twoerner
Target Milestone: ---   
Target Release: ---   
Hardware: All   
OS: Linux   
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2015-07-13 14:03:20 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Bug Depends On: 855346, 1201782    
Bug Blocks: 1014209    

Description Stephen Gallagher 2015-07-10 20:04:45 UTC
Description of problem:
Because earlier versions of python3-gobject did not have a base-only version, firewalld is pulling in cairo and much of the graphical stack. Please update the requirement in the spec file so that Fedora 23 install media will require less space.

Version-Release number of selected component (if applicable):
firewalld-0.3.14.2-2.fc23

How reproducible:
Every time

Steps to Reproduce:
1. Create a minimal mock buildroot
2. Install firewalld into the buildroot

Actual results:
Many unnecessary packages are pulled in (dependencies of python-cairo)


Expected results:
Only the packages necessary for firewalld operation should be pulled in.

Additional info:

Comment 1 Thomas Woerner 2015-07-13 14:03:20 UTC
Fixed in firewalld-0.3.14.2-3.fc23
http://koji.fedoraproject.org/koji/buildinfo?buildID=668475